Six People Face Charges After Drugs Were Accessible to a Child

Six people were taken into custody in Fayette County after deputies said they found drugs, scales, drug paraphernalia and needles in easy reach of a small child. The six were charged with child neglect creating risk of serious bodily injury and conspiracy to commit a felony, according to the Fayette County Sheriff’s Office. Fayette deputies responded to do a Child Protective Services home check in Oak Hill and the six adults were taken into custody.
